The market around Greater Grvs Ph 1

Greater Grvs Ph 1 is a small community — 6 recorded sales on file, most recently in 2024 — too few for its own price trend. Here is the market around it.

In ZIP 34714, 378 homes are on the market and 31% are under contract — a fast-moving corner of CLERMONT.

Across Lake County, 3,224 homes are active and 1,105 pending (26% under contract).

Homes here are single family residence.

ZIP and county figures describe the wider market, not Greater Grvs Ph 1 specifically. Momentum Research analysis of MLS records.

A community without a clear data trail yet

Some Clermont communities have enough transaction history to show a clear price band, a typical time on market, or a defined buyer pattern. Greater Grvs Ph 1 does not currently show that in the MLS feed, which puts the burden of due diligence on individual listings rather than community averages.

That is not a red flag by itself. Newer phases, low turnover, or a small number of active listings can all produce this picture. It does mean a buyer or seller should treat every comparison here as home-to-home, not neighborhood-to-neighborhood.

How many homes are in Greater Grvs Ph 1?
The Florida DOR 2025 assessment roll shows 161 homes in Greater Grvs Ph 1 (public records).
What share of Greater Grvs Ph 1 is owner-occupied?
68% of Greater Grvs Ph 1 parcels carry a homestead exemption on the 2025 Florida DOR roll, the owner-occupancy proxy in public records.
When were the homes in Greater Grvs Ph 1 built?
Homes in Greater Grvs Ph 1 were built between 1992 and 2001, with a median year built of 1996 (FL DOR 2025 roll).
